Creating a Functional and Aesthetic Living Space
Creating a functional and aesthetic living space involves a harmonious blend of practicality and visual appeal. Start by evaluating your needs; consider how you use the space and the activities you engage in daily. Select furniture and decor that not only complement your personal style, but also optimize functionality—multi-purpose pieces can save space while enhancing utility. Incorporate color palettes and textures that evoke the desired mood, whether it's calming or energizing. Use lighting strategically to highlight key features while ensuring adequate illumination for varied tasks. Finally, don’t forget about greenery; plants enhance air quality and bring a vibrant, organic touch to your home.

Benefits of Minimalism on Mental Health
Minimalism offers numerous benefits for mental health, primarily by fostering a sense of clarity and calm in an often chaotic world. By simplifying one's surroundings and reducing clutter, individuals can create a more serene environment that promotes focus and reduces stress. This deliberate curation of belongings helps alleviate feelings of overwhelm, allowing for greater mental clarity and enhanced decision-making. Additionally, minimalism encourages individuals to prioritize experiences over possessions, fostering deeper connections with loved ones and promoting emotional well-being. As people shed unnecessary distractions, they often find they have more time for self-care and mindfulness, ultimately leading to improved mental health and overall happiness.
